As part of the annual Cape Cod Hydrangea Festival, we celebrate the iconic plant that makes the Cape so stunning from July through September. Enjoy fabulous photo opportunities as you stroll through the gardens and be sure not to miss two featured gardens which together make up the most comprehensive collection of hydrangeas in North America. The Cape Cod Hydrangea Society Display Garden boasts a collection of over 155 exceptional cultivars, around 60% of which are legacy varieties no longer in cultivation anywhere else. The North American Hydrangea Test Garden features over 240 of the newest varieties of hydrangeas being vigorously tested and evaluated here, growing alongside companion plants, providing garden design inspiration. Take a self-guided tour to discover more about this signature plant, learn to identify, select, and care for your hydrangeas from Cape Cod Hydrangea Society volunteers in the gardens, capture the beauty of the blooms during an art-making activity, and more! All extra hydrangea-focused activities are free with museum admission or membership. No advance registration required.
